Important Update: Changes to AllFly’s Ticket Protection Plan

Ticket Protection Plan for Delta, American, and United Airlines corporate travel bookings ends after June 1, 2024, due to policy changes.

We hope this message finds you well. We are writing to inform you of an important update regarding our Ticket Protection Plan for economy tickets on Delta, American, and United Airlines.

Effective immediately, our Ticket Protection Plan will be sunsetted for all corporate travel programs booking after June 1, 2024. This change is necessary due to recent modifications in the airlines' rules and policies. 

It’s important to note that the TPP is still a part of our Group Contracts offering. Group Contracts are a special product that airlines sell and require 10+ people to be on the same exact flight. We do NOT recommend group contracts for corporate and event travel, and most of our customers take our advice.

Key Dates to Remember
  • June 1, 2024: Last day to book programs that will be covered by the Ticket Protection Plan.
  • July 1, 2024: The official end date for the Ticket Protection Plan. Any tickets issued after this date will not be covered by the plan, regardless of when the program began booking.
Impact on Your Bookings
  • Programs that began booking prior to June 1, 2024, will still be covered under the Ticket Protection Plan, as long as tickets are issued by June 30, 2024.
  • For programs booking after June 1, 2024, the Ticket Protection Plan will no longer be available.
Managing the Transition
  • If your program began booking before June 1, 2024,, the TPP will still be honored until the final cutoff on July 1, 2024. After this date, all tickets purchased will not be eligible for the TPP.
Our Future Plans

To address this gap, we are working diligently to introduce the option to purchase refundable tickets directly within Quest. This new offering will provide similar benefits to the Ticket Protection Plan, allowing you to secure more flexible travel arrangements.

Managing Canceled Tickets

In the corporate travel world, non-refundable tickets that are canceled typically result in an e-credit on the traveler’s profile. We understand this can be frustrating for companies trying to manage travel expenses efficiently. We recommend establishing internal travel policies to govern these situations, and we are here to offer our expertise and consultation to help you navigate these changes.
